GoFundMe announced for Carson City family who lost everything in house fire Sunday morning
On Sunday morning, a Carson City family lost everything in a home fire.
The following comes from the GoFundMe:
Hi everyone. I am setting up this Go Fund Me to kindly request your support for my older brother, Armando Silis and his family (Girlfriend, their 2-year-old son and his father-in-law) who lost everything this Sunday, January 7, 2024 when our family home burned down.
At approximately 9:30AM my brother and his family woke up to the fire alarms ringing and all they had time for was to run out the door with what they had on. The house was filled with smoke and in a matter of seconds the home went up in flames and within no time all their furniture and belongings, along with the family home, were destroyed.
Armando is one of the kindest and hardest working individuals that you will ever meet. He has been working since he was 14 years old and has always taken pride in providing for his family and trying to always help his loved ones.
The fire also burned all of Armando’s tools which he had been slowly acquiring for doing side jobs on top of his full time job. His girlfriend, Yasmine had recently started her own photography business to contribute to the family, but unfortunately the fire also destroyed her cameras, computer and equipment for her small business.
